Memory Module capacity calculation
As mentioned previously, capacity is calculated using DRAM characteristics, specically technology, width, and the
total number of ranks. ECC must be considered in calculating the amount of DRAMs needed, but the ECC DRAM(s)
are only used to hold the ECC values and should not be counted as part of the actual data payload which denes the
DIMM capacity.
To calculate the capacity of a DIMM, the type of DRAMs used must be understood. The width of the DRAM should be
used to nd the number of DRAMs needed to make up the data bus. The capacity per rank can then be calculated by
multiplying the number of DRAMs by the size of the DRAM, and further divided by 8 to convert bits into bytes. The
total DIMM capacity is nally calculated by multiplying the rank capacity and the number of ranks on the DIMM.
Below are two examples:
8 GB unbuered, dual-rank, ECC DIMM
Rank width = [9 DRAM] x [x8 width] = 72 bits
Rank capacity = [8 payload DRAM] x [4 Gb technology] / [8 bits] = 4 GB
DIMM capacity = [2 ranks] x [4 GB per rank] = 8 GB
64 GB registered, quad-rank, ECC DIMM
Rank width = [18 DRAM] x [x4 width] = 72 bits
Rank capacity = [16 payload DRAM] x [8 Gb technology] / 8 bits = 16 GB
DIMM capacity = [4 ranks] x [16 GB per rank] = 64 GB
The max capacity available today, with 8 Gb based RDIMMs, is 64 Gigabyte (GB).
Label decoder
The following should be used to understand key attributes about the type of memory that is loaded in a system.
When looking at the DIMM label, you should see the following format:
gggGB pheRx PC4v-wwwwaa-mccdt-bb
ggg = Module total capacity, in gigabytes
phe = Number of package ranks of memory installed and number of logical ranks per package rank.
p = # of package ranks installed
h = DRAM package type
e = Logical ranks per package rank
